From 593cccb16074fe9269dd2f278bd79859769eb1fd Mon Sep 17 00:00:00 2001 From: Andrei Karas Date: Sat, 8 Sep 2012 00:17:45 +0300 Subject: Improve constructors in some classes. --- src/utils/xml.cpp |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) (limited to 'src/utils/xml.cpp') diff --git a/src/utils/xml.cpp b/src/utils/xml.cpp index 4d434f46a..f25d867a6 100644 --- a/src/utils/xml.cpp +++ b/src/utils/xml.cpp @@ -90,12 +90,9 @@ namespace XML } } - Document::Document(const char *const data, const int size) + Document::Document(const char *const data, const int size) : + mDoc(data ? xmlParseMemory(data, size) : nullptr) { - if (data) - mDoc = xmlParseMemory(data, size); - else - mDoc = nullptr; } Document::~Document() -- cgit v1.2.3-60-g2f50